The cornerstone of a successful partnership lies in rigorous supplier verification. Moving past glossy websites and generic catalogs is non-negotiable. Begin by demanding evidence of technical competence specific to your industry. A professional precision injection mold maker will readily provide detailed case studies, preferably with video of tools in operation, and list the specific brands of machining centers (e.g., Makino, GF Machining Solutions) and measurement equipment (e.g., Zeiss CMM) they operate. Verify business licenses and export history, but go further. Initiate a video conference for a virtual factory tour; a reputable supplier will have no issue showcasing a clean, organized workshop with well-maintained machinery. This real-time view is invaluable for assessing their operational discipline and technological level, key indicators of their ability to handle complex injection mold projects.

Once a potential partner passes initial verification, the focus must shift to a meticulous pre-production quality control protocol. The adage “quality cannot be inspected into a product” is paramount in mold making. Your technical discussions must center on their Design for Manufacturability (DFM) process. A reliable China mold factory will proactively provide a comprehensive DFM report, highlighting potential issues with part design, gate locations, ejection, cooling, and material selection before a single block of steel is cut. Insist on a formalized Approval Process for all critical stages: 3D mold design review, steel material certificates, first article inspection (FAI) reports from the cavity and core, and pre-shipment sampling. Clearly define the measurement reports required, specifying CMM data over simple caliper checks. Establishing these checkpoints collaboratively, and in writing within the purchase order, aligns expectations and prevents costly misunderstandings.

Effective procurement strategy extends beyond unit price to encompass total cost of ownership and project management transparency. Be wary of quotes that seem abnormally low; they often signal corner-cutting on steel grade, component quality, or engineering time. Instead, seek detailed, line-item quotations that break down costs for materials, design, machining, trials, and finishing. Discuss their project management framework: who is your single point of contact? What is their standard process for weekly progress updates, typically including photos or videos of machining milestones? How do they handle engineering change requests (ECRs)? A professional precision injection mold maker operates with this level of structured communication, ensuring you are never in the dark. The final, and often most critical, phase is the pre-shipment sampling and logistics planning. Never approve a mold for shipment based on pictures alone. Require a sampling trial at the China mold factory using a material identical or very close to your production material. The output from this trial—the T1 samples—must be rigorously measured and functionally tested against your approved master sample or CAD data. Accompanying this should be a complete mold trial report documenting process parameters, cycle times, and any adjustments made. This step is your ultimate quality control. Simultaneously, plan logistics with care. Molds are high-value, heavy, and sensitive. Ensure the supplier has experience in proper packaging (often wooden crates with desiccant) and can handle all export documentation (commercial invoice, packing list, customs declaration). Decide on Incoterms clearly; FOB is common, but for high-value tools, consider the control offered by CIF.
